Update on my nephew - Peyton


mckayleesmom wrote: Yesterday my mom called from my sisters house...she had the kids outside playing. Peyton is starting to finally try to hold his head up and lean forward in his walker. He has a new therapist...and the old one also visits. The new therapist has a cart that he leans on and he is starting to try to push with his legs. The therapist also got him to start eating some solid food..bananas...He doesn't like doing it though,,but its progress. My sister has been giving him pediasure a couple times a day...and some kind of medamusal drink (he has trouble pooping, because he doesn't have the muscles to do it well..they usually have to use suppositories and help him get it out)......But just wanted to let eveyone know hes making a little progress. My sister also got the approval to send his records to a hospital in Texas that specializes in delayed and Mentally handicapp children. They also have approval for his MRI to be done within the next 5 months (long waiting list). He also has a new specialized carseat that still faces backwards and is made just for him and his body.

jcc64 replied: I think the first time you posted about this I mentioned the importance of early intervention with dd kids. It makes such a HUGE difference, and it clearly seems to be the case for your little nephew. It's also critical for your sister to have the support and guidance from the therapists, who have a unique perspective on what parents of dd kids go through. I think in time your sister will learn to adjust her expectations of what your nephew can and can't do, and every little achievement will be a joyous occasion. Kids so often overcome and surpass dismal early predicitions of how much they're capable of achieving.
